Spring break is a time to relax, unwind, and have some fun away from the daily responsibilities of life. One of the most popular activities for spring break is a Beach Day. Whether you're traveling to a far-off destination or staying closer to home, there's nothing quite like spending time by the ocean. Here are some tips for making the most out of a Beach Day during your spring break.

First, decide on the perfect location. There are countless beaches around the world, so think about what you want out of your experience. Do you want to party with college friends or have a quiet day with family? Some popular spring break destinations include Cancun, Miami Beach, and Panama City Beach. If you're looking for something a little quieter, consider smaller coastal towns like Tybee Island or Newport Beach.

Once you have your location, plan out your day. Start by packing the essentials - sunscreen, towels, and plenty of water. If you plan on spending a lot of time in the water, bring along some goggles or snorkeling gear. Don't forget a good book or a game to play with friends, as well as some snacks or a picnic lunch.

When you arrive at the beach, stake out your spot for the day. Choose a spot that's close to the water but still has some shade, and set up your towels and beach chairs. Apply sunscreen liberally and frequently throughout the day to avoid painful sunburns.

Once you're settled in, hit the water! Whether you're swimming, surfing, or paddleboarding, the ocean is a perfect way to cool off and have some fun. Be sure to follow any safety guidelines and stay within any designated swim areas.

After a day of beach activities, wind down with some relaxing time on your towel or beach chair. Take in the view of the ocean and the sunset, and reflect on the relaxing day you had. Finally, clean up your belongings and dispose of any trash to leave the beach better than you found it.

Spring break is the perfect time of year to enjoy nature and all it has to offer. One of the best ways to do this is through hiking. No matter where you live, there is sure to be a hiking trail nearby that will appeal to both experienced and beginner hikers. Here are some tips to help you get the most out of your spring break hiking adventure.

Research the Trail

Before heading out for your hike, it is important to do some research on the trail you will be hiking. This will give you a better idea of what to expect and help you prepare accordingly. Some things to consider include the length of the trail, the terrain, and the weather conditions. It is also a good idea to check for any potential hazards such as wildlife or difficult sections of the trail.

Pack the Essentials

When hiking, it is important to come prepared with the right gear. This includes appropriate footwear, a backpack with plenty of water, snacks, and any necessary medications or first aid supplies. It is also a good idea to bring extra layers of clothing, as the weather can change quickly on a hiking trail.

Take Time to Enjoy the Scenery

While hiking is great exercise, it is also a chance to get away from the hustle and bustle of everyday life and enjoy the scenery. Take breaks along the way to admire the natural beauty and take pictures. Spring is a great time to see blooming wildflowers and beautiful landscapes.

Follow the Trail Rules

When hiking, it is important to respect the trail and those around you. Stay on designated paths, avoid littering, and remember to leave nature as you found it. Also, be mindful of any wildlife you may encounter.

When planning a camping trip, the first thing to consider is the location. With so many sites to choose from, it's essential to do some research beforehand. Some popular campsites include national parks, state parks, and private campgrounds. National parks like Yosemite, Grand Canyon, and Yellowstone offer breathtaking sceneries and a vast array of activities like hiking, rock climbing, and kayaking. State parks also offer unique experiences, such as beach camping and scenic bike trails. Private campgrounds, on the other hand, offer various amenities like showers, restrooms, and swimming pools.

When packing for a camping trip, one must consider the essentials. Depending on the location and length of the trip, one might need to pack camping gear such as a tent, sleeping bags, and cooking equipment. It's also essential to pack appropriate clothing, insect repellent, sunscreen, and first aid kit.

While camping, there are plenty of activities to enjoy. Depending on the location, one can hike, fish, swim, and enjoy a bonfire at night. It's a great time to disconnect from technology and enjoy the scenery around you. While camping, it's also essential to follow the Leave No Trace principles to preserve the environment for others.

One of the biggest draws of a theme park for spring break is the sheer variety of activities available. From fast-paced roller coasters to classic carnival games, there is no shortage of things to see and do. Many parks also offer a range of shows and parades, which can be a great way to unwind and enjoy some entertainment after a long day of rides.

If you are looking for a classic theme park experience, there are a few top locations to consider. Orlando's Walt Disney World Resort is a perennial favorite, with its four distinct parks (including Magic Kingdom and Epcot Center) offering something for everyone. Other popular options include Universal Studios and Islands of Adventure, both in Orlando, and Southern California's Disneyland Resort.

For those looking for a more unique experience, there are plenty of theme parks that offer a twist on the traditional format. For example, Dollywood in Tennessee is a mix of country music and thrills, with a focus on Southern charm and hospitality. Meanwhile, Legoland in California offers rides and attractions themed around beloved block toys.

No matter where you go for your theme park adventure, it is important to keep in mind a few key tips for making the most of your visit. First, be sure to check the park's hours and schedule in advance to avoid any surprises. You may also want to consider purchasing tickets online ahead of time to save time and frustration at the gate.

It's also a good idea to pack accordingly – comfortable shoes, sunscreen, and plenty of water are all must-haves for a day at the park. And if you are traveling with kids or a large group, consider setting up a meeting point or two in case anyone gets separated.
